About The Position

Boeing Defense Space & Security (BDS) has an exciting opportunity for a Senior Production Project Management Specialist (Level 4 or 5) supporting the P-8 Foreign Military Sales (FMS) Program in Tukwila, WA. This is a full time onsite role with work from home flexibility. The position is a key member of the P-8 Production Program Management Team responsible for leading the preparation and execution of a new contract award of P-8A Airplane deliveries to the US Navy and their Foreign Military Sales (FMS) customers. This role will be pivotal in collaborating with the proposal team to get the final contract fully defined by the end of the year and leading the baselining of cost, schedule, and deliverables leading the cross-functional Control Account Manager (CAM) community and holding the program accountable to delivering on-time, on-cost, and meet or exceed technical performance requirements. This position interacts with senior management and external customers on a regular basis and requires a keen sense of urgency while maintaining a mindset that promotes leadership and first-time quality, emphasizing speed and agility with honesty and candor.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ience have with Project Planning, Scheduling, Project Management or related experience.
  • Bachelor's degree equivalent combination of education and work related experience.
  • 1+ year of experience working with Microsoft Office including Outlook, Excel, Word, PowerPoint, SharePoint, and Teams.
  • 3 years of experience in utilizing Microsoft Excel, including formulas, pivot tables, and linking worksheets.
  • 3+ years of experience in a customer facing role engaging with internal and/or external customers.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ience performing with a significant amount of autonomy and exercise good judgment in determining objectives and approaches to assignments.
  • Significant aerospace and defense knowledge.
  • Bachelor's degree or higher in engineering, business or technical field.
  • Active Secret clearance pre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Build and develop customer relationships both with US Navy and FMS customers as an external spokesperson for the program, while managing export control and data sharing requirements.
  • Responsible for developing project plans, advises all project phases, and acting as primary customer contact for project activities.
  • Effectively communicates project expectations to team members and stakeholders in a timely and clear fashion.
  • Directs and provides high level studies/analysis (trend, variance, impact), determines scope, reports, and oversight of planning requests.
  • Identifies risks, issues and opportunities, leads planning and actively manages cross-functional mitigation plans.
  • Skill and ability to collect, organize, synthesize, and analyze data; summarize findings; develop conclusions and recommendations from appropriate data sources.
  • Keeps prioritization of quality product delivery and customer requirements in the forefront while executing the process and strategy for integration of plans and schedules.
  • Develops and contributes to continuous improvements for both individual work and team processes, develops solutions to complex problems, works independently, and initiates assignments while recognized as a job expert within the team and organization.
